Ultrasound Tech Work Description<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"BayonneThere are several professional tit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also referred to as ultrasound technologists, sonogram techs, and di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ers). Regardless of name, they all have the same basic job function, which is to perform diagnostic ultrasound procedures on patients. Although many work as generalists there are specializations within the field, for example in pediatrics and cardiology.
